** spoiler alert ** "Ah, penny, brown penny, brown penny,
I am looped in the loops of her hair."

I liked the diction in these poems and the lyrical quality of many of them as well as the references to history/mythology. Nothing really personally striking for me but enjoyable nonetheless.

Reading the poems on their own would probably not have been as enjoyable without the tight curation and timeline done by the editor. The further context in the notes at the end really gave me a better appreciation for some of the poems as they were, grounded in Yeats' lives.
